Moses Gbagbe-Sowah, a dedicated offensive lineman for the Rutgers Scarlet Knights, has made significant strides despite not seeing game action in the last two seasons.

Standing at 6 feet 1 inch and weighing 295 pounds, he has established a strong presence in college football through his commitment and skills.

Moses Gbagbe-Sowah is not only known for his athletic abilities but also for his academic achievements.

He was named Academic All-Big Ten in 2022, showcasing his commitment both on the field and in the classroom. His dedication has earned him a following and recognition, important factors for his NIL valuation.

Despite not disclosing his NIL amount, Moses continues to be an essential part of his team.

His journey from Newark, NJ, to becoming a valuable Rutgers player speaks to his hard work and dedication.

Moses Gbagbe-Sowah – NIL Money Analysis

Name, Image, and Likeness (NIL) opportunities have reshaped how college athletes like Moses Gbagbe-Sowah earn money.

Since the NCAA allowed athletes to profit from their NIL in 2021, players have secured deals ranging from local endorsements to national sponsorships.

Although exact figures for Moses Gbagbe-Sowah’s NIL earnings are not publicly available, athletes in major college programs often earn through promotional work and social media endorsements.

Rutgers players benefit from increased visibility which enhances their earning potential.

NIL deals provide a substantial financial boost for college athletes, allowing them to capitalize on their fame while still in school.

This change has created opportunities to earn money legally, complementing their academic and athletic commitments.
